Implats

Impala Platinum Holding Limited (Implats) is a leading producer of platinum group metals (PGMs), structured around six mining operations and a toll refining business, Impala Refining Services. Our mining operations span the Bushveld Complex in South Africa, the Great Dyke in Zimbabwe and the Canadian Shield and include Impala Rustenburg, Zimplats, Marula, Impala Canada, Mimosa and Two Rivers. The Group’s head office is in Johannesburg. We are listed on the JSE Limited in South Africa and have a level 1 American Depositary Receipt programme in the US. Implats employs more than 56 000 people across all operations. The Group aspires to create a better future, deliver value through excellence and execution, and is committed to responsible stewardship and long-term value creation. At the end of its 2021 financial year, the Group had PGM mineral resources of 277 million 6E ounces and mineral reserves of 53.4 million 6E ounces available. Group refined PGM production for FY2021 was 3.27 million ounces, which included 1.52 million ounces of platinum, 1.12 million ounces of palladium and 193 000 ounces of rhodium. We actively develop markets for our PGM products, which are sold in South Africa, Japan, China, the US and Europe. Orion Minerals

Orion Minerals, dual-listed on the Australian and Johannesburg Stock Exchanges (ASX: ORN, JSE: ORN), is a globally diversified resource company set to become a new generation base metals producer through the development of its Prieska Copper-Zinc Project in South Africa’s Northern Cape Province.
Since acquiring Prieska in 2015, Orion has rapidly made this brownfields project one of the few fully permitted, bankable and development-ready base metal assets worldwide.
Underpinned by a globally significant JORC compliant VMS Resource of 30.49Mt @ 1.2% Cu and 3.7% Zn, Prieska is forecast to produce ~22ktpa of copper and ~70ktpa of zinc over an initial 12-year life, generating A$1.6 billion in pre-tax free cash flow and a pre-tax NPV8% of A$779 million.
An emerging producer of the “future-facing” commodities required for global mega-trends such as decarbonisation and electrification, Orion has set new standards with its approach to ESG, community and stakeholder engagement, permitting and technology adoption, and is playing a leadership role in the resurgence of junior mining in South Africa.
Orion is working to complete project financing for Prieska, targeting production start-up in 2024. Website: orionminerals.com.au

Royal Bafokeng Platinum

Royal Bafokeng Platinum (RBPlat) is a mid-tier platinum group metals (PGMs) producer, originating from a joint venture between Anglo American Platinum and Royal Bafokeng Holdings (RBH) known as the Bafokeng Rasimone Platinum mine joint venture (BRPM JV). In 2018 RBPlat became the 100% owner of its business, following the acquisition of the 33% portion of the BRPM JV from Anglo American Platinum. RBPlat mines platinum group metals in the Merensky and UG2 reefs on the Boschkoppie, Styldrift and Frischgewaagd farms in the Rustenburg area which have been identified as hosting the last undeveloped Merensky reef on the Western limb of the Bushveld complex. RBPlat’s assets are the only known significant shallow high grade Merensky resources and reserves still available for mining in South Africa. Sasol Mining

Sasol Mining operates six coal mines that supply approximately 40 million tons per annum of thermal coal feedstock to Sasol’s operations in Secunda and Sasolburg, South Africa and to the export market. Our main operations comprise the Mooikraal colliery near Sasolburg in the Free State, and the Bosjesspruit, Impumelelo, Shondoni, Syferfontein and Thubelisha collieries and Twistdraai export operations at Secunda in Mpumalanga, South Africa. We export approximately 3,3 Mtpa through our shareholding in RBCT. Website: www.sasol.co.za/about-sasol/operating-business-units/mining/overview

Seriti Coal

Seriti Resources Holdings Pty Ltd ("Seriti Holdco") is a broad-based, 91% black-owned and controlled coal mining company. Seriti, through its operating subsidiary, Seriti Coal Pty Ltd, currently operates three large-scale, opencast and underground thermal coal mines namely, New Vaal, New Denmark and Kriel Collieries, and owns various life extension coal resources, New Largo project and closed collieries. As a major South African mining company, Seriti supplies approximately 24Mtpa of thermal coal to the Lethabo, Tutuka and Kriel power stations which are collectively responsible for the generation of approximately a quarter of South Africa's electricity. Seriti is Eskom's largest black-controlled coal supplier with a clear focus on providing secure, long-term coal supply solutions to fuel Eskom's fleet of power stations. Seriti, together with partners, intends to develop the New Largo project into a large-scale, opencast coal mine capable of providing the base load fuel requirements for Kusile Power Station. Website: https://seritiza.com

Sibanye-Stillwater

Sibanye-Stillwater is an independent, global precious metal mining group, producing a unique mix of metals that includes gold and the platinum group metals (PGMs). Domiciled in South Africa, Sibanye-Stillwater owns and operates a portfolio of high-quality operations and projects, which are grouped by region: the Southern Africa (SA) region and the United States (US) region. Globally, Sibanye-Stillwater is the third largest producer of palladium and platinum and features among the world’s top ten gold companies. The Southern Africa region houses the gold and PGM operations and projects located in South Africa and Zimbabwe. Our underground and surface gold mining operations in South Africa are the Driefontein and Kloof operations in the West Witwatersrand (West Wits) region of Gauteng and the Beatrix operation in the southern Free State. PGM assets in the Southern Africa region are Kroondal (50%PSA), the Rustenburg Operations (100%) and the tailings retreatment entity, Platinum Mile (91.7%) in North West Province, and Mimosa (50%) in Zimbabwe. The US region houses our PGM operations and projects located in the United States, Canada Argentina. These include the East Boulder and Stillwater mining operations which includes the Blitz project in Montana, in the United States, and two exploration-stage projects, Marathon, a PGM-copper porphyry in Ontario, Canada, and Altar, a copper-gold property in San Juan, Argentina. Website: www.sibanyestillwater.com

Rand Mutual Assurance

Rand Mutual Assurance (RMA) was founded in 1894 by three mining companies as a mutual assurance company to insure and administer workmen’s compensation benefits. It was incorporated as a public company, and, as a mutual association, all policy holders automatically became shareholders. Years later, the South African government implemented legislation to regulate workers’ compensation benefits and RMA was issued a licence by the then Minister of Labour in terms of Section 30 of the Compensation for Occupational Injuries and Diseases (COID) Act (Act 130 of 1993). The licence allowed RMA to continue providing and administering workers’ compensation to the mining sector (Class IV) and was later extended to include employers from the iron, steel, artificial limbs, galvanising, garages, metal, and related industries (Class XIII) on 1 March 2015.
